The hardware provides internet ability to detect and observe frequencies from 300 MHz to 1000 MHz (adding the dev board grants access to even higher frequencies nearing 2.6GHz in length.

The best part is not just the air sniffing but the added ingenuity of exposing internet circuits through the GPIO (General Purpose Input Output) panel on the top of the device. With internal apps that can manually send and read signals through this panel is a great tool with a breadboard, some circuit knowledge, and imagination to create, connect, or even buy modules that can detect CO2, Radiation, and any extra sense available in a circuit board in today’s amazon store with this IO standard.
